Solution for 3(2.5+.5y)+y=10 equation:


Simplifying
3(2.5 + 0.5y) + y = 10
(2.5 * 3 + 0.5y * 3) + y = 10
(7.5 + 1.5y) + y = 10

Combine like terms: 1.5y + y = 2.5y
7.5 + 2.5y = 10

Solving
7.5 + 2.5y = 10

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-7.5' to each side of the equation.
7.5 + -7.5 + 2.5y = 10 + -7.5

Combine like terms: 7.5 + -7.5 = 0.0
0.0 + 2.5y = 10 + -7.5
2.5y = 10 + -7.5

Combine like terms: 10 + -7.5 = 2.5
2.5y = 2.5

Divide each side by '2.5'.
y = 1

Simplifying
y = 1
